III. Technique #1: Embrace the Pomodoro Technique
Let’s kick things off with a classic—The Pomodoro Technique. This method is all about breaking your work into focused intervals, traditionally 25 minutes long, separated by short breaks. Here’s how you can implement it:
- Choose a task you want to work on.
- Set a timer for 25 minutes and dive into your work without distractions.
- When the timer goes off, take a 5-minute break. Stretch, grab a drink, or just breathe.
- Repeat this process four times, and then take a longer break of about 15-30 minutes.

V. Technique #3: Setting SMART Goals
Let’s get a bit more strategic with SMART goals. This acronym stands for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, and Time-bound. By setting clear goals, you create a path to follow, enhancing your focus and boosting productivity:
- Specific: What do you want to achieve?
- Measurable: How will you track your progress?
- Achievable: Is it realistic considering your resources?
- Relevant: Does it align with your larger objectives?
- Time-bound: What’s your deadline?
For example, instead of saying, “I want to work on my project,” you could say, “I will complete the first draft of my project by Friday at 5 p.m.” Clear, right? This clarity helps me stay focused on the steps I need to take.

VII. Technique #5: Mastering Time Blocking
Another nifty technique is time blocking. This strategy involves scheduling specific blocks of time for various tasks. By allocating time, you reduce overwhelm and improve focus. Here’s how it works:
- Identify your key tasks for the day.
- Assign each task a dedicated time slot on your calendar.
- Stick to the schedule as closely as possible.
